小鼠Lrh-1基因与排卵数间相关性分析

Correlation analysis of Lrh-1 gene and ovulation number in mice

【摘要】 目的探讨肝受体类似物-1(liver receptor homolog-1,Lrh-1;NR5A2)基因序列差异与小鼠排卵数性状间关系。方法根据GenBank中NM001159769序列设计了5对引物扩增Lrh-1基因CDS区,用单链构象多态性(Single-strand conformation polymorphism,SSCP)分析小鼠Lrh-1基因序列差异,分析Lrh-1基因与小鼠排卵数间关系。结果①在5对引物中只有引物P2和P5扩增产物存在多态性,引物P2扩增产物存在两种基因型AA和AB型,其中AB型发生(C674A)突变,这种突变导致编码的140位氨基酸由谷氨酰胺变为赖氨酸。②引物P5扩增产物存在三种多态类型SSCP-1、SSCP-2和SSCP-3,SSCP-1和SSCP-3型核酸序列比SSCP-2型少25个碱基,SSCP-3型除缺失区段外,其他区域碱基序列与SSCP-2型有5处碱基突变,而与SSCP-1型核酸序列有34处碱基差异,经BLAST分析,SSCP-2型与NM001159769序列相似,SSCP-1型与NM001159769序列相差较多,而与NG012313.1序列相似,通过氨基酸序列比对分析,SSCP-3型1652处的A→G的突变导致氨基酸由丙氨酸变为苏氨酸,1678位G→C的突变使原密码子TAC(酪氨酸Y)变为TAG(终止子)。③引物P2 AA型(27.27±8.52)与AB型小鼠的平均排卵数(25.92±11.73)间差异无显著性(P>0.05);引物P5 SSCP-2型平均排卵数(35.00±14.58)显著高于SS-CP-3型平均排卵数(19.50±7.94)(P<0.05),SSCP-1型(26.2±8.18)与SSCP-2型、SSCP-3型平均排卵数间差异无显著性(P>0.05)。结论明确了Lrh-1基因序列差异与小鼠排卵数性状间关系,为深入研究Lrh-1基因对动物生殖调控机理提供依据。

【Abstract】 Objective To explore the correlation of liver receptor homolog-1(Lrh-1;NR5A2) gene nucleotide sequence and ovulation number in mice.Methods Five primers were designed according to the sequence of NM001159769 and amplified the coding sequence of Lrh-1 gene.Single-strand conformation polymorphism was used to analyze the correlation of difference in Lrh-1 nucleotide sequence and ovulation number.Results(1) There were polymorphisms in P2 and P5 PCR products.The P2 PCR products had two genotypes: AA and AB.The AB genotype had one base mutation of C674A,and the mutation led to amino acid change of Q140K.(2) The P5 PCR products had three SSCP-types: SSCP-1,SSCP-2 and SSCP-3.The nucleotide sequences of SSCP-1 and SSCP-3 had 25 base deletion than SSCP-2 type.Five base mutations between SSCP-3 and SSCP-2,34 base mutations between SSCP-3 and SSCP-1 were found.When BLAST in NCBI,the nucleotide sequence of SSCP-2 was like NM001159769,but SSCP-1 sequence was like NG012313.1.The base mutation of A1652G caused alanine changed to threonine and the base mutation of G1678C caused tyrosine changed to termination codon in peptide chain of SSCP-3 type.(3)There was no significant difference of average ovulation numbers between AA genotype(27.27±8.52) and AB genotype(25.92±11.73) in P2 PCR products(P>0.05).In P5 PCR products,the SSCP-2 type(35.00±14.58) had a significantly higher average ovulation number than SSCP-3 type’s(19.50±7.94)(P<0.05).Conclusions Definite correlations of Lrh-1 gene and ovulation number have been established in mice.The results will contribute to the research of Lrh-1 gene molecular mechanism and regulatory pathway in animal reproduction.
